In an exclusive clip from tomorrow’s new episode, Kirk and Rasheeda are talking about their ongoing co-parenting challenges with Jasmine Washington, the mother of Kirk’s son, Kannon.

The couple isn’t holding back as they share their frustrations over what they see as Jasmine’s failure to prioritize the now 8-year-old son’s well-being.

“I don’t know what its state inspection looks like, but I’m about to find out thanks to Ms. Jasmine,” says Kirk alluding to ongoing tensions over financial and parental responsibilities.

Rasheeda also expresses her concerns, emphasizing that despite the past, Kannon’s needs should come first.

“I’m not with none of the bulls***. I just feel like Kannon needs to be taken care of. Regardless of whatever it is that you do, it seems like it’s not enough,” says Rasheeda.

“So, as you ignored and moved on, she just keep pushing and poking and poking and poking. But you know what? I thought maybe over the years, and with Kannon now being 8, maybe she had matured as a woman and understood that her son should be her priority.”

A frustrated Rasheeda then questions Jasmine’s motives in a confessional, implying that her focus is more on financial gain than on Kannon’s well-being.

“I can’t believe it’s been 8 years and Jasmine still doesn’t understand how to put Kannon’s needs in front of her own. Kannon is such an amazing kid, and he deserves the world. Too bad his mama don’t realize that’s the important part and it’s not all about her,” says the rapper who agrees with him that Jasmine is too focused on being taken care of too.

As the couple continues to vent, Kirk shares that the situation has now become a legal battle, and he thinks it’s all a money grab.

“There’s only one way to get everything straight. Now get the paperwork straight,” he said. “And guess what? When she got her little attitude, talking all that to all her little friends, I just wanted to tell her, ‘But remember, you brought me here. I’m in court and I’m going to trial because of you—because it wasn’t enough money.’”
